你查询的IP:[124.220.78.225]  地理位置:中国–上海–上海

最新查询123.253.137.169 124.31.202.105 59.80.38.166 116.198.239.93 122.4.192.78 118.224.68.162 125.96.59.226 122.198.6.41 210.32.155.197 124.220.78.225 125.104.242.0 167.139.160.42 203.79.162.115 59.64.47.76 124.192.95.192 202.38.184.103 116.76.193.64 114.54.108.157 202.91.176.222 222.192.5.22 203.92.160.124 121.204.17.176 221.129.106.8 118.67.112.2 58.68.128.27 123.244.74.103 125.208.195.37 59.172.69.73 218.240.138.91 218.108.116.230 118.24.30.83